Summary
The Scarborough, Hull and York Pathology Service (SHYPS) is seeking a motivated Biomedical Scientist to work in the busy, friendly, Point of Care Testing (POCT) department at Hull Royal Infirmary.
Based primarily in Hull, your role will be to supervise the day to day running of the POCT department. You will be required to perform routine maintenance and troubleshooting of POCT equipment and oversee stock levels of reagents and consumables in all analytical areas. The post holder will be expected to work efficiently following departmental health and safety procedures and ensure that any problems are reported to the line manager. The post holder must ensure that personal proficiency and competencies are maintained and must be willing to take part in any training required to maintain an up-to-date knowledge of equipment and techniques. We are looking for an individual who is hard working, innovative, sociable, and works well as part of a busy team. Previous experience in POCT is desirable but not essential.
• To follow departmental standard operating procedures and health and safety rules at all times.
• To take part in any training necessary for an up-to-date knowledge of all equipment, techniques and maintenance required in areas in which they work.
• To identify problems within the areas that they are working and report them to their manager.
• To maintain clear and concise communication with users of the service at all times.
• To ensure that all work is carried out in compliance with ISO standards.
• To provide training to clinical staff as/when required.

Our benefits
We offer a range of benefits to support our staff including:
• Access to the NHS Pension Scheme, providing generous benefits upon retirement, as well as a lump sum and pension for dependants
• 27 days holiday rising to 33 days (depending on NHS Trust service)
• A variety of different types of paid and unpaid leave covering emergency and planned leave
• Confidential advice and support on personal, work, family and relationship issues, 24/7, from our Employee Assistance Programme
• NHS Car Lease scheme and Cycle to Work scheme
• An extensive range of learning and development opportunities
• Discounts on restaurants, getaways, shopping, motoring, cinema and finance from a range of providers
